From Mariah Carey & Kelly Price (live at St. John’s Divine Christmas Concert) to Ben Folds (1993), Lenny White (1988) & Pic Conely (1994) I have been blessed to have worked with some of today’s finest artists.

While at C.C.N.Y working towards my bachelors in music I had the opportunity to study alongside Arturo O’ Farrill . Arturo had composed a special arrangement of the schools Alma mata song “Oh Lavender” that we performed during a spring Commencement ceremony.
C.C.N.Y provided the environment that allowed me the honor and privilege to study under jazz vocalist Sheila Jordan & the legendary bassist Ron Carter.

In 1991-1992 I toured the U.S. and Canada with the first Equity Broadway production of The Buddy Holly Story.

Also, in 1991 U.K. Pop sensation Kenny Thomas recorded my song “Girlfriend” co written with R & B producer Bert Price. The album was entitled “Voices” and went double platinum.

In 1996 I landed a position at WPIX-TV and in 2000 I was hired as a full time Engineer.

In 1997 I broke into the Billboards pop 100 singles chart with a remake of the BJ Thomas / Blue Suede hit “Hooked on a Feeling”.

In 2009 I released my first project as a record label executive “Green Heart”. The roster of musicians that I had the pleasure of working with were as follows: Toninho Horta, Nilson Matta, Romero Lubambo, Ze’Luis, Paulo Braga and Jerry Jemmot.

Today I am a proud partner in a new and exciting music label City Boys Mike Productions L.L.C.
